Treatment of Subcutaneous Adipose Tissue in the Thighs Using High Intensity Focused Ultrasound

A Study to Investigate the Safety and Efficacy of Treatment of Subcutaneous Adipose Tissue in the Thighs Using the Liposonix System (Model 2)

Summary

The purpose of this study is to assess the safety and efficacy of treatment with the Liposonix System (Model 2) for the circumferential reduction of subcutaneous adipose tissue (SAT) of the thighs.

Detailed description

Subjects received a single treatment (Liposonix System) on one randomly assigned thigh. The opposite thigh was not treated and served as a control for each subject.
